British Columbia Min of Transportation select Exor

Denver, Colorado; August 6 2008: Exor Corporation is pleased to announce the selection by British Columbia Ministry of Transportation of Exor, the leading supplier of infrastructure asset management solutions, to upgrade and enhance its roadway inventory asset management program.

British Columbia undertook an intensive market review in order to replace its existing asset inventory system. The Exor solution will replace its legacy system and enhance its capabilities by incorporating state of the art field data collection technology, introduce web based reporting and include the ability for British Columbia to synchronize to the provincial Digital Road Atlas (DRA).

Linking to the DRA provides a single and common map for all provincial government agencies, with a shared data update procedure that creates a more accurate map for use by those agencies.

Exor has formed a strategic alliance with British Columbia and its subcontractors, TC Technology, Vivid Solutions and ESRI, on the one million dollar project that includes a new field data collection module, due to be in full use for the end of the 2008 summer field collection period.

The new field survey application will significantly improve the efficiency and accuracy of the data collection by enabling British Columbia district office staff and contractors to collect multiple inventory items simultaneously whilst driving along the highway. Asset locations will be established using measures from Distance Measuring Instruments and global navigation satellite systems in the survey vehicles.
